  2. Blair, for the rear suspension, I cut the springs down and removed half of the rear crossmember. I then added a styrene brace on top of the crossmember for reinforcement. For the front, I seperated the control arms which allowed me to mount them 1mm higher. I will then cut the tab/spindle and relocate the hole higher, thus lowering the front end.
